Duties and responsibilities
- Develop & execute research/evidence based short & long-range recruiting and marketing plans that are measureable for all the academic units within CHHS based on financial, demographic and target market factors.
- Attend AU Enrollment meetings, as assigned
- Maintain a spreadsheet of prospective students and applicants.
- Actively participate in Preview events and all similar on-campus events planned by Enrollment Office. Must be comfortable giving presentations in front of larger groups of students and parents
- Organize and participate in college recruitment tours and Career Fairs (offsite and onsite) - Adventist, Christian, community college and major transfer schools. This includes a fall tour of all NAD Adventist colleges, selected regional public and private colleges, and SDA Academies (Academy Career Day).
- Keep website and social media updated and checked to ensure information is correct and appealing, as well as responding to any questions asked by virtual visitors
- Keep in constant contact via emails/ text messages/ phone with all prospective undergraduate and graduate students (accepted, applicants, and recruits) so as to encourage them to attend Andrews or to complete an application.
- Establish and maintain relationships with resource (health care and design) professionals and other key supporters within the community.
- Foster relationships with advisors at feeder schools (SDA, Christian and community)
- Manage prospective students and develop ongoing programs to nurture candidates toward enrollment.
- Conduct qualified applicant interviews according to the requirements of various professional programs in close consultation with department chairs.
- Any other tasks as requested by the Dean of the College of Health & Human Services.
- Develop a comprehensive annual marketing & recruiting budget.
- Prepare activity and financial reports of recruiting endeavors.
- Direct prospective students and families to the appropriate student financial advisor in Student Financial Services for financial information including scholarships, grants, loans and payment options.
- Work collaboratively with Marketing & Enrollment Management (MEM) team.
- Consult with AU’s Chief Marketing Officer for the development of marketing plans and resources.
- Collaborate programs with CHHS and MEM to develop marketing materials that will assist in on the road and campus-based recruiting activities.
